Title | Copy letter from Herbert Rix, to Professor Michael Foster, [Royal Society] |
Date | 29 July 1889 |
Description | Rix encloses a memorandum, and asks if the leaves of Mr Bateman's paper would assist in the arrangement of the plate, but asks that they be returned as they are not yet in type.
He has not yet succeeded in getting Mr France's paper started.
Professor Edward Albert Schafer has decided on the Autotype Company for three of his plates, and West, Newman & Company for the fourth, and so these firms are to be put in communication with Schafer, and Foster should soon receive estimates. Schafer has also sent enclosed correspondence and a list of members regarding [Eadweard James] Muybridge, and so Rix asks Foster to instruct Mr James about what to do, namely whether he is to write to Muybridge for the photographs or whether they will come to the Royal Society from America. Rix notes that the subcommittee never met, and he supposes that the final list of plates was left with Muybridge as it was not sent to him. |
